What are exponential growth and decay?

A rise in the resultant quantity for a given quantity is referred to as exponential growth, and a decrease in the resultant quantity for a given quantity is referred to as exponential decay. Over time, exponential functions monitor constant growth. Examples from the actual world include radioactive decay, compound interest, and bacterial proliferation.

The standard form of an exponential equation is y = a(b)ˣ  

where a is the initial value

b is the rate

Exponential decay is where the final value (y) is less than the initial value (a). An example would be the decrease of bacteria in a person

Exponential growth is where the final value (y) is greater than the initial value (a). An example would be the spreading of a rumor.

Jim and sue both take a driving test. the probability that Jim will pass the driving test is 0.7. The probability that Sue will pass the driving test is 0.6.
a) work out the probability that both Jim and Sue will pass the driving test.
b) work out the probability that only one of them will pass the driving test.

please help

Answers

Answer:

the above images shows the answer to the question

Final answer:

The probability that both Jim and Sue will pass the driving test is 0.42. The probability that only one of them (either Jim or Sue) will pass the driving test is 0.46.

Explanation:

This question falls under probability in Mathematics. To solve for these probabilities, we multiply the individual probabilities together.

a) The probability that both Jim and Sue will pass the driving test is found by multiplying the two probabilities together: 0.7 (Jim's probability) * 0.6 (Sue's probability) = 0.42. So, the probability that both will pass is 0.42.

b) The probability that only one of them will pass the driving test is found by adding the probability of the two independent events: Jim passes and Sue fails, or Sue passes and Jim fails. Jim passing and Sue failing would be 0.7 * (1 - 0.6) = 0.28. Sue passing and Jim failing would be 0.6 * (1 - 0.7) = 0.18. Adding these together, the probability that only one of them will pass is 0.28 + 0.18 = 0.46.
